Cap de la Solana
Cap de la Solana is a peak in Les Llosses, Girona, Catalonia and has an elevation of 1,262 metres. Cap de la Solana is situated nearby to the locality Molí de Santa Eugènia, as well as near les Muntanyetes.Places of Interest

Sant Jaume de Frontanyà
Village
Photo: Aracelifoto,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Sant Jaume de Frontanyà is a municipality in the comarca of the Berguedà in Catalonia, Spain. It is situated in the Pyrenees below the peak of Pedró de Tubau.
La Pobla de Lillet
Village
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
La Pobla de Lillet is a municipality in the comarca of the Berguedà in Catalonia. It is located in the upper valley of the Llobregat river and is linked to Guardiola de Berguedà by Road B-402.
